The Paintworks is to hold host to Bristol’s first Hot Tub Cinema event this October, proving yet again that when it comes to upholding the brand of the UK’s coolest city, Bristol is doing all it can!
That’s right, you can watch classic films while luxuriating in a hot tub, eating popcorn and hotdogs, sipping a beer and then stay on for a tub-hopping party afterwards.
The Hot Tub Cinema’s guiding mantra is that they don’t just watch films, they celebrate them. So you are encouraged to dress up, sing, dance, drink and play. Oh, and enjoy your favourite films from the comfort of a hot tub, of course.
